The paper is devoted to the verification of Software Defined Networking (SDN) components and their compositions. We focus on the interaction between three basic entities, an application, a controller, and a switch. The paper is devoted to testing critical Software Defined Networking (SDN) components and in particular, SDN-enabled switches. A switch can be seen as a forwarding device with a set of configured rules and thus, can be modelled and analyzed as a ‘stateless' system.
